Ixtapa-Zihuatanejo
With the best and most beautiful sunsets on the Pacific, Ixtapa-Zihuatanejo offers a wide variety of activities. You can tour its bike path, venture to Ixtapa Island, tour its center or simply relax in a hotel.
Ixtapa-Zihuatanejo is a small and safe destination, so you will be able to get to know it well in less than a week. There is public transportation that takes you from the hotel zone to the center of Zihuatanejo easily. There are also various tour operators that do not ask for a minimum number of people to carry out tours.
sayulita
This Magical Town is the destination hippy par excellence of Mexico. Surrounded by beautiful colors, quiet beaches, handicrafts, galleries, bars, restaurants, and boutique hotels, Sayulita has so much to offer solo travelers.
Also, Sayulita is full of people who live or travel alone, so it will be very easy for you to meet new people and make friends. It is a great opportunity to enjoy the bohemian and artistic life on your own that this Nayarit beach offers.
Mexico City
With incredible museums, parks, bookstores, exhibitions, concerts, restaurants, terraces and attractions, Mexico City is ideal for a trip without companions. The possibilities of activities are really endless in the capital so you will have many options to plan your getaway alone.
You can also enjoy various events that you can attend alone or simply spend a whole day in a museum of your choice, have a coffee in the Roma or ride a bike on a Sunday along the Paseo de la Reforma.
Royal of Fourteen
Traveling to Real de Catorce is like traveling back in time. In this Magical Town you will not have internet and you will find yourself surrounded by desert and mountains, making it an ideal getaway for those seeking a spiritual journey and connecting with nature.
Also, Real de Catorce is very safe and you can explore the whole town on foot, so it is perfect for a solo trip. You can also find several options for tours and activities to do that you will undoubtedly enjoy, such as horseback riding, going to Cerro del Quemado or visiting the Ghost Town.
Women Island
Peace and tranquility are breathed in the turquoise of the Mexican Caribbean. If you are looking for a quiet getaway where you have the opportunity to connect with nature, Isla Mujeres is ideal for traveling alone.
The island can be explored in golf carts and there are various lodging options. Likewise, the island receives tourists every day who come from Cancun, so you will undoubtedly be able to meet many people, even foreigners, and dare to leave your comfort zone.

Recommendations for traveling alone
- Investigate well the place where you want to go and take the necessary luggage. We also recommend that you bring hygiene products and medicines necessary to take care of your health, such as repellent, sunscreen, paracetamol, aspirin, etc.
- Be clear about what you want to do and start planning the trip your way.
- Do not be afraid to leave your comfort zone, encourage yourself to meet new people, to do different things and try that food that is not common in your city.
- Keep in touch with your family, partner or friends so they know you’re okay. Although a trip is only to spend time with yourself, you should not leave other people worried. You can even share your location live through google to be more secure.
